AES Andes commits USD 3 billion to new large-scale solar and energy ...

The announcement comes after the utility entered the latest solar-plus storage scheme, called Solar Oriente, to the environmental permitting queue. According to its environmental impact statement (EIS), Solar Oriente is designed to be a large-scale power complex featuring a 581.5-MWp solar photovoltaic plant and a BESS of up to 809.2-MW. Large-Scale Solar Siting Resources | Department of Energy

There is approximately 115 TW of solar photovoltaic potential in the U.S., which includes 1 TW on buildings, 27 TW on agricultural land, 2 TW on brownfields, and 2 TW for floating solar. The U.S. Department of Energy (DOE) Solar Energy Technologies Office (SETO) conducts research to reduce the cost and impact of siting solar. We''ve answered ...

Overview on hybrid solar photovoltaic-electrical energy storage ...

Hybrid photovoltaic-pumped hydro energy storage system. PHES (Pump Hydro Energy Storage) is the most mature and commonly used EES [33]. It is especially applicable to large scale energy systems [34], occupying up to 99% of the total energy storage capacity [35]. To further promote the penetration of renewable energy, PHES …
